Abstract

To provide a crosslinkable fluorinated elastomer composition which is excellent in crosslinking reactivity and of which a crosslinked product is excellent in heat resistance and chemical resistance. The crosslinkable fluorinated elastomer composition comprises a fluorinated elastomer (e.g. a tetrafluoroethylene/perfluoro(alkyl vinyl ether) copolymer) and an aromatic compound having at least two crosslinkable unsaturated double bonds (e.g. a compound represented by the formula (A-1)), and the crosslinked product is one obtained by crosslinking the crosslinkable fluorinated elastomer composition.

Claims (23)

1. A crosslinkable fluorinated elastomer composition, comprising a fluorinated elastomer and an aromatic compound having at least two crosslinkable unsaturated double bonds,

wherein the aromatic compound having at least two crosslinkable unsaturated double bonds, comprises a fluorinated aromatic compound having at least two of group (1) represented by the following formula (1):

wherein s is 0 or 1, and each of R 1 , R 2 , R 3 and R 4 which are independent of one another, is a hydrogen atom or a fluorine atom,

and the fluorinated aromatic compound having at least two of said group (1) comprises either one or both a fluorinated aromatic compound (A) represented by the following formula (A) and a fluorinated aromatic compound (B) having said group (1) and an ether bond, obtained by subjecting a fluorinated aromatic compound (x) represented by the following formula (x), either one or both of an aromatic compound (y1) having said group (1) and a phenolic hydroxy group and an aromatic compound (y2) having said group (1) and a fluorine atom substituting an aromatic ring, and an aromatic compound (z) having at least three phenolic hydroxy groups, to a condensation reaction in the presence of a HF elimination agent:

wherein, n is an integer of from 0 to 6, a is an integer from 0 to 5, b is an integer of from 0 to 4, c is an integer of from 0 to 4, a+c+n is from 2 to 6, a+b is from 2 to 9, Z is a single bond, —O—, —S—, —CO—, —C(CH 3 ) 2 —, —C(CF 3 ) 2 —, —SO— or —SO 2 —, Rf 1 is a C 1-8 fluoroalkyl group, each of Y 1 and Y 2 which are independent of each other, is said group (1), and F in the aromatic ring represents that hydrogen atoms of the aromatic ring are all substituted by fluorine atoms,

wherein N is an integer of from 0 to 3, each of d and e which are independent of each other, is an integer of from 0 to 3, each of Rf 2 and Rf 3 which are independent of each other, is a C 1-8 fluoroalkyl group, and F in the aromatic ring represents that hydrogen atoms of the aromatic ring are all substituted by fluorine atoms,

wherein the content of the aromatic compound having at least two crosslinkable unsaturated double bonds, is from 0.1 to 15 mass % based on the mass of the fluorinated elastomer.

2. The crosslinkable fluorinated elastomer composition according to claim 1 , wherein the aromatic compound having at least two crosslinkable unsaturated double bonds, has at least two vinyl groups or allyl groups bonded to an aromatic ring.

3. The crosslinkable fluorinated elastomer composition according to claim 1 , wherein the aromatic compound having at least two crosslinkable unsaturated double bonds further comprises an aromatic hydrocarbon having at least two vinyl groups bonded to an aromatic ring.

4. The crosslinkable fluorinated elastomer composition according to claim 1 , wherein the fluorinated aromatic compound (x) is at least one selected from the group consisting of perfluorobenzene, perfluorotoluene, perfluoroxylene, perfluorobiphenyl, perfluoroterphenyl, a perfluorotriphenyl benzene, a perfluorotetraphenyl benzene, a perfluoropentaphenyl benzene and a perfluorohexaphenylbenzene.

5. The crosslinkable fluorinated elastomer composition according to claim 1 , wherein the aromatic compound (z) is at least one selected from the group consisting of trihydroxybenzene, trihydroxybiphenyl, trihydroxynaphthalene, 1,1,1-tris(4-hydroxyphenyl) ethane, tris(4-hydroxyphenyl) benzene, tetrahydroxybenzene, tetrahydroxybiphenyl, tetrahydroxybinaphthyl and a tetrahydroxyspiroindane.

6. The crosslinkable fluorinated elastomer composition according to claim 1 , wherein the fluorinated aromatic compound (A) is one which satisfies both conditions

that each of R 1 , R 2 , R 3 and R 4 in Y 1 and Y 2 in the formula (A) is a hydrogen atom, and

that in the formula (A), c is 0, or c is an integer of from 1 to 4 and Rf 1 is a C 1-8 perfluoroalkyl group.

7. The crosslinkable fluorinated elastomer composition according to claim 6 , wherein the fluorinated aromatic compound (A) is a compound represented by the following formula (A-1) or (A-2):

8. The crosslinkable fluorinated elastomer composition according to claim 1 , further comprising an organic peroxide, and wherein the content of the organic peroxide is from 0.1 to 5 mass % based on the mass of the fluorinated elastomer.

9. The crosslinkable fluorinated elastomer composition according to claim 1 , wherein the fluorinated elastomer comprises iodine and/or bromine atoms.

10. The crosslinkable fluorinated elastomer composition according to claim 1 , wherein the fluorinated elastomer is a perfluoroelastomer.

11. The crosslinkable fluorinated elastomer composition according to claim 1 , wherein the fluorinated elastomer is a tetrafluoroethylene/perfluoro(alkyl vinyl ether) copolymer having an iodine atom at a polymer chain terminal.

12. The crosslinkable fluorinated elastomer composition according to claim 1 , further comprising a crosslinking aid other than the aromatic compound having at least two crosslinkable unsaturated double bonds, and wherein the content of the crosslinking aid is from 0.1 to 3 mass % based on the mass of the fluorinated elastomer.

13. The crosslinkable fluorinated elastomer composition according to claim 12 , wherein the mass ratio of the aromatic compound having at least two crosslinkable unsaturated double bonds/the crosslinking aid other than the aromatic compound is from 1/30 to 150/1.

14. The crosslinkable fluorinated elastomer composition according to claim 12 , wherein the crosslinking aid other than the aromatic compound having at least two crosslinkable unsaturated double bonds is triallyl isocyanurate.

15. A crosslinked product obtained by crosslinking the crosslinkable fluorinated elastomer composition according to claim 1 .
